-
I'd like to explore adding property-based tests with fuzzing tools like http://jwilk.net/software/python-afl, https://hypothesis.readthedocs.org/en/latest/, and https://bitbucket.org/ebo/pyfuzz. Here…
-
The PEG parser produces locations for an AST that span the entire AST node. This is well defined, and has a number of desirable properties such as the span of a node including all its children's spans…
-
I am using graph_wrap version 0.1.3, Django 3.2, djangrestframework 3.12.4, graphene 3.2.2, graphene-django 3.1.2
1. When I run "python manage.py runserver", there are no errors report.
2. When I …
-
# Official Documentation
- Introduction (make a case for Hermes)
- Quick Start (example Python parser using the REPL)
- Installation
- Hermes Grammar File Format
- Lexical Analyzer
- Introduction (w…
-
As a member of the team, I need to learn how to automate editing Python code via Syntax Trees
by watching a formal presentation on the topic
so that I can work on implementing ASTs and automating co…
-
``` haskell
prettyText $ Py.Class (Py.Ident "Hello" ()) [] [] ()
```
Should give:
``` python
class Hello:
pass
```
But currently the "pass" is missing.
-
Originally reported by: **BitBucket: [ceridwenv](http://bitbucket.org/ceridwenv), GitHub: @ceridwen**
---
This method is now redundant, given the ast_from_class function in raw_building. Should I m…
-
Originally reported by: **BitBucket: [ceridwenv](http://bitbucket.org/ceridwenv), GitHub: @ceridwen**
---
As an example, take _newstyle_impl in scoped_nodes.py. It caches its result in self._newsty…
-
Originally reported by: **BitBucket: [ceridwenv](http://bitbucket.org/ceridwenv), GitHub: @ceridwen?**
---
This method is now redundant, given the ast_from_class function in raw_building. Should I …
-
Originally reported by: **BitBucket: [ceridwenv](http://bitbucket.org/ceridwenv), GitHub: @ceridwen?**
---
As an example, take _newstyle_impl in scoped_nodes.py. It caches its result in self._newst…